The ADS8912BRGER is an 18-bit analog-to-digital converter from Texas Instruments, offering a sampling rate of 500k SPS. It features a single input channel and utilizes an SPI interface for efficient digital communication. The S/H-ADC architecture ensures accurate sample capture, and the external reference option allows for precise voltage scaling. Packaged in a 24-VFQFN with exposed pad, this ADC is designed for high-precision applications in measurement, aerospace, and scientific research.

  • Exceptional Resolution: 18-bit accuracy provides ultra-precise signal conversion for demanding measurements.
  • High Sampling Rate: 500k SPS enables capture of fast-changing signals without compromising resolution.
  • External Reference: Allows for precise voltage scaling to match specific application requirements.
  • Wide Temperature Range: Operates from -40°C to 125°C, suitable for extreme environments.
  • Compact Package: 24-VFQFN with exposed pad offers space savings and improved thermal dissipation.
